The multi-axis laser cutting industry focuses on the precision cutting of materials using laser technology across multiple axes. This process involves the use of laser beams to cut, engrave, or etch materials with high precision and speed. Multi-axis laser cutting machines operate on more than the traditional two axes, often incorporating three to five axes, allowing for complex geometries and intricate designs. This capability enables the cutting of three-dimensional shapes and contours that are not possible with standard two-dimensional laser cutting. The process begins with the generation of a laser beam, which is then focused onto the material's surface. The intense energy of the laser beam melts, burns, or vaporizes the material, creating a precise cut. The multi-axis capability allows the laser head to move in various directions, providing flexibility in cutting angles and depths. Materials commonly used in multi-axis laser cutting include metals such as steel, aluminum, and titanium, as well as non-metals like plastics, ceramics, and composites. The choice of material depends on the specific application and the desired properties of the final product. Multi-axis laser cutting finds applications in various industries, including aerospace, automotive, medical device manufacturing, and electronics. In aerospace, it is used for cutting complex components with high precision and minimal material waste. The automotive industry utilizes this technology for producing intricate parts and components that require high accuracy. In the medical field, multi-axis laser cutting is essential for manufacturing surgical instruments and implants with precise dimensions. The electronics industry benefits from this technology in the production of circuit boards and other components that demand exact specifications. Multi-axis laser cutting offers advantages such as reduced production time, increased accuracy, and the ability to create complex shapes without the need for additional tooling. This makes it a valuable process in industries that require high precision and efficiency in manufacturing.

With the acceleration of the U.S. economy and the implementation of new tariffs, domestic demand for the products produced by precision machining, and the tools to fabricate them, is on the rise. The new duties affect a wide range of components including parts for aircraft gas turbines, engine parts, machining centers for working metal, lathes and waterjet cutting machinery. The increased expense of importing machined items is promoting both the growth of existing U.S. precision machining shops and the startup of new ones. Manufacturing Day kicks off on Oct. 6, 2017. Since 2012, Manufacturing Day has inspired manufacturers to host thousands of public events. Manufacturing Day is more than a collection of trade shows, however. Today, it's a nationwide platform for job seekers, educators, students, media, and even politicians to celebrate the resurgence of American manufacturing. Manufacturing Day has grown exponentially over the past several years. From 2012 to 2013 alone, official events held nationwide nearly quadrupled. In total, the number of Manufacturing Day events has risen 1,000 percent since its inauguration. The rise of Manufacturing Day coincides with a manufacturing renaissance in the U.S., which has the potential to create millions of well-paying jobs.
